Introduction
The global nanomagnetic market refers to the industry focused on nanoscale magnetic materials used across advanced applications such as electronics, healthcare, data storage, and energy systems. The materials demonstrate their distinctive magnetic characteristics when measured at the nanoscale, which creates pathways for developing devices with high efficiency, precise performance and small-sized designs. The applications of nanomagnetic technologies extend to magnetic sensors and spintronics, memory devices, and medical fields, which include targeted drug delivery, imaging and cancer treatment. The market is expanding because customers need high-density data storage, researchers develop new nanotechnology, and companies increase their research and development funding. The increasing demand for compact electronic devices that use less power is creating more opportunities for widespread technology implementation. The growth of electric vehicles, wireless communication systems, and renewable energy technologies creates additional development opportunities. Worldwide, nanomagnetic materials provide essential support for developing cutting-edge technologies and scientific research.

Nanomagnetic Market Size & Statistics
- The Market Size for Nanomagnetic Was Estimated to be worth USD 2.51 Billion in 2025.
- The Market is Going to Expand at a CAGR of 9.29% between 2025 and 2035.
- The Global Nanomagnetic Market Size is anticipated to reach USD 6.1 Billion by 2035.
- North America is expected to generate the highest revenue during the forecast period in the Nanomagnetic Market
- Asia Pacific is expected to grow at the fastest rate during the forecast period in the Nanomagnetic Market.

Regional growth and demand
Asia Pacific is expected to grow at the fastest rate during the forecast period in the nanomagnetic market. The expansion results from two main factors, which include industrialization and, increased funding for nanotechnology research and rising demand for sophisticated electronic and semiconductor products. The manufacturing capabilities of China, Japan and India, together with their government initiatives to promote research development, have positioned these nations as leading industrial powers.
North America is expected to generate the highest revenue during the forecast period in the nanomagnetic market. The existing research and development facilities, combined with major technology firms and their advanced healthcare solutions, data storage systems and their active research in nanotechnology and electronics development work together to create this effect.

- Rising Demand for High-Density Data Storage
The nanomagnetic market experiences its main trend through increasing demand for storage solutions that can handle high-density data requirements. The digital data generated by cloud computing, artificial intelligence and IoT devices requires the development of storage solutions that use compact and efficient technologies. Nanomagnetic materials enable advanced memory solutions such as MRAM and spintronic devices, which provide faster processing speeds, increased storage capacity and reduced energy consumption when compared to traditional systems. These technologies serve as essential components for both contemporary data centers and modern consumer electronic devices. The rising global data generation process makes nanomagnetic solutions necessary for developing future storage systems.
- Growing Applications in Biomedical and Healthcare Sectors
Biomedical and healthcare fields now utilize nanomagnetic materials because these materials possess distinct properties that exist at nanoscale dimensions. Researchers use magnetic nanoparticles in targeted drug delivery systems, which enable precise drug administration to specific body areas, thus enhancing treatment effectiveness while minimizing adverse effects. The treatment method uses magnetic hyperthermia to fight cancer, while the system provides contrast material for MRI imaging. The applications help doctors perform less invasive treatments while achieving better results through medical tests. Rising needs for better health solutions and specific medical treatments make nanomagnetic technologies essential for changing current medical practices.
- Miniaturization of Electronic and Semiconductor Devices
The trend toward smaller, faster, and more efficient electronic devices is driving the adoption of nanomagnetic materials. The development of consumer electronics and semiconductor technologies creates a requirement for components that need less space yet provide superior performance. The nanoscale properties of nanomagnetic materials enable miniaturization because they deliver better magnetic characteristics, which make these materials suitable for sensors, memory devices and integrated circuits. This supports the development of compact smartphones, wearables, and advanced computing systems. The demand for lightweight portable electronics drives nanomagnetic technology innovation because it creates a need for this technology in all future electronic device designs.
- Advancements in Spintronics Technology
Spintronics, or spin-based electronics, operates as a fast-developing scientific field that harnesses electron spins together with their electrical charge. The technology depends on nanomagnetic materials, which enable faster data processing, better storage capacity and lower energy usage. Spintronics provides next-generation computing systems with better performance and non-volatile memory capabilities, which differentiate it from conventional electronic systems. Researchers currently develop new magnetic memory devices and logic circuits through their active research and development work. The increasing demand for fast computers that use less energy will drive spintronics to become a major force behind upcoming developments in nanomagnetic technology.

- IBM Corporation
Headquarters: Armonk, New York, USA
As the primary leader of the nanomagnetic market, IBM Corporation conducts its research activities while developing advanced spintronics and magnetic memory technologies. The company focuses on developing next-generation data storage solutions that use MRAM and nanoscale magnetic devices to enhance speed and efficiency while reducing energy consumption.IBM uses its strong research and development capabilities together with its research partnership operations to achieve ongoing progress in nanotechnology development. The artificial intelligence, cloud computing and quantum technology fields benefit from IBM's research work in nanomagnetic technology.IBM uses its advanced materials science and engineering knowledge to help develop future high-performance computing systems and next-generation electronic systems throughout the world.
- Fujitsu Limited
Headquarters: Tokyo, Japan
Fujitsu Limited is a major contributor to the nanomagnetic market, focusing on advanced electronic components and data storage technologies. The company invests heavily in research related to spintronics and magnetic memory devices, which aim to improve computing performance and energy efficiency. Fujitsu uses nanomagnetic materials in its semiconductor and IT solutions to develop small and fast devices. The company serves multiple industries, which include telecommunications and computing, through its global reach and commitment to innovation. Fujitsu maintains its leadership in next-generation electronics because of its ongoing technological developments while playing a vital role in advancing nanomagnetic technologies.
- Samsung Electronics Co., Ltd.
Headquarters: Suwon, South Korea
Samsung Electronics Co., Ltd. operates as a worldwide leader in the electronics and semiconductor industry while investing in nanomagnetic technology research for its memory and storage systems. The company develops advanced memory systems that include MRAM technology, which uses nanomagnetic materials to achieve faster data processing and improved efficiency. Samsung uses its semiconductor production capabilities and nanoscale technology advancement to create electronic components that deliver exceptional performance. The organization investigates spintronics and magnetic materials to build next generation devices. Samsung operates as a global leader while driving the growth of nanomagnetic technology across the consumer electronics market and computing sector.
- Honeywell International Inc.
Headquarters: Charlotte, North Carolina, USA
Honeywell International Inc. holds a crucial position in the nanomagnetic market because the company specializes in developing advanced materials and sensor technologies through its research work. The company uses nanomagnetic materials to improve performance and precision in its aerospace, industrial automation, and sensing applications. Honeywell focuses on innovation and development of high-performance magnetic sensors and systems that improve efficiency and reliability. The company develops industrial solutions through its powerful engineering capabilities and dedicated research investments, which enable it to implement nanotechnology. Honeywell uses its various business assets and technological knowledge to advance nanomagnetic technology throughout different industries worldwide.
- Hitachi Metals Ltd.
Headquarters: Tokyo, Japan - Hitachi Metals Ltd. serves as a major player within the nanomagnetic industry through its production of high-performance magnetic materials and components. The company develops advanced alloys and magnetic products used in electronics, automotive systems, and industrial applications. Through their research work on material science, they develop new, efficient and dependable nanomagnetic components. Hitachi Metals invests in research to enhance magnetic properties and improve product performance at the nanoscale. The company's expertise in advanced materials, combined with its worldwide operations, enables it to support the creation of future electronic devices while driving growth in the nanomagnetic industry.
